18 Hunters Hill, High Wycombe, HP13 7EW is a leasehold flat built between 1976-1982. The property offers approximately 1,292 square feet of living space.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have four b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£275,952 , which equates to approximately £214 per square foot. It was last sold on 17 Aug 2001 for £116,000. Since then, the value has increased by £159,952, representing a 137.9% increase, or approximately 5.7% per year.

The current estimated value of £275,952 is:

  • 17.2% higher than the average property price on Hunters Hill
  • 17.5% higher than the average in the HP13 7EW postcode area
  • and 28.3% lower than the average price for High Wycombe as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ded once as rented and once as owner-occupied, indicating a change in how it was used over time.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 28 April 2025, the property was recorded as rented.

EPC Summary

18 Hunters Hill, High Wycombe, Wycombe, Buckinghamshire, HP13 7EW has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of E, based on the latest assessment carried out on 28 Apr 2025.

This property uses electric storage heaters as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from off-peak electric immersion heater.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 8 Oct 2013. The rating of E rem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 4.5%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The hot water energy efficiency changing from average to very poor, while the system remained as electric immersion, off-peak.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from flat, no insulation (assumed) to flat, limited insulation (assumed), improving energy efficiency from very poor to poor.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, filled cavity to cavity wall, as built, partial ins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from good to average.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 67%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 73%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from good to very good.
